All Changes

🥽VR(4)

  • changeVR belt: Reimplemented the VR belt following player feedback.
  • newVR belt: Added the ability to switch Journal and Walkie Talkie placement between the belt and shoulder.
  • changeVR belt: VR belt visibility is now local-only; other players see equipment on the player's body.
  • fixSpirit Box: Fixed an issue where VR players were unable to use Text Input for the Spirit Box, Monkey Paw, and Ouija Board.

👻Ghosts(3)

  • nerfGhost: Reverted line of sight ghost speed accelerations to their original state.
  • fixKormos: Fixed an issue that allowed the Kormos to kill players through floors.
  • fixKormos: Fixed an issue that allowed the Kormos to kill players outside.

🔦Equipment(2)

  • fixSpirit Box: Fixed a softlock occurring when using the Spirit Box before interacting with the Truck’s CCTV.
  • fixTier 3 Firelight: Fixed an issue where the Tier 3 Firelight would not work correctly if placed while lit.

👥Multiplayer & UI(2)

  • fixMultiplayer: Fixed an issue where player jackets appeared incorrectly when loading into a lobby.
  • fixMultiplayer: Fixed an issue where joining without a code caused lobby creation errors and removed game audio.

Summary

VR Improvements

The VR belt has been restored to the game, allowing players to choose between belt or shoulder placement for their Journal and Walkie Talkie. VR players also regain text input functionality for cursed possessions and the Spirit Box. Note that the VR belt is only visible locally; other players will see equipment attached to the body.

Gameplay & Ghost Balance

Ghost speed acceleration during line of sight has been reverted to its original state prior to the Player Character Update. Additionally, the Kormos ghost has been fixed to prevent it from killing players through floors or while they are outside.

Stability & Bug Fixes

Several technical issues have been addressed, including a softlock when using the Spirit Box and a bug that removed game audio when attempting to join multiplayer lobbies without a code. Developers also noted that players on older Windows versions may need to update their OS to resolve voice chat connectivity issues caused by a security certificate update.
